The vehicle-to-grid (V2G) technology market is set to experience rapid growth, with the market valued at USD 5.54 billion in 2024 and projected to reach USD 49.75 billion by 2034, growing at a CAGR of 28.13%. This growth is driven by increasing demand for electric vehicles (EVs) and the need for sustainable energy solutions. V2G technology enables EVs to not only charge from the grid but also supply power back, contributing to grid stability and energy efficiency. The market’s expansion is further supported by advancements in battery storage systems and smart grid technologies, as well as growing environmental awareness and government incentives promoting clean energy solutions.

Market Drivers
The vehicle-to-grid (V2G) technology market is driven by several key factors. The increasing adoption of electric vehicles (EVs), especially battery electric vehicles (BEVs), is a significant driver, as it creates a growing demand for charging infrastructure and grid management solutions. As EVs become more prevalent, the need for technologies like V2G to support grid stability, energy efficiency, and storage solutions becomes critical. The expansion of renewable energy sources, which often face intermittency challenges, also drives the need for V2G technology to balance supply and demand on the grid. Government incentives and regulatory policies promoting clean energy and EV adoption further boost the market growth. Additionally, advancements in electric vehicle supply equipment (EVSE) and battery storage technologies enhance the functionality and attractiveness of V2G systems, contributing to their market expansion. The anticipated growth of plug-in hybrid electric vehicles (PHEVs) with a strong CAGR also indicates increased demand for integrated grid solutions.

Challenges
- High initial infrastructure and installation costs for V2G systems, which may deter widespread adoption.
- Regulatory and policy hurdles in integrating V2G technologies with existing grid systems and energy markets.
- Concerns over the impact of V2G technology on battery lifespan and vehicle performance, which could affect consumer acceptance.
- Lack of standardization in V2G protocols, creating challenges in interoperability across different vehicle models and charging infrastructure.
- Limited awareness and understanding of V2G benefits among consumers and industry stakeholders.
Regional Insights
Europe leads the vehicle-to-grid (V2G) technology market, holding the largest market share of around 35.80% in 2024. The region is at the forefront of EV adoption, supported by strong government policies and incentives promoting clean energy and electric vehicle infrastructure. North America is also a significant player in the market, driven by the growing popularity of electric vehicles and advancements in smart grid technologies. The U.S. is actively developing V2G solutions to improve grid stability and energy efficiency, especially with increasing renewable energy penetration. Asia Pacific is rapidly emerging as a key market for V2G technology, driven by rising EV adoption, particularly in countries like China, Japan, and South Korea. The region’s large-scale investments in electric vehicle infrastructure and renewable energy sources contribute to the growth of V2G systems. The Middle East and Africa are in the early stages of V2G technology development, with emerging interest in sustainable energy solutions and electric vehicles, offering future growth potential for V2G.
